Target Background

Function(From Uniprot)
Cell surface receptor that transfers passive humoral immunity from the mother to the newborn. Binds to the Fc region of monomeric immunoglobulin gamma and mediates its selective uptake from milk. IgG in the milk is bound at the apical surface of the intestinal epithelium. The resultant FcRn-IgG complexes are transcytosed across the intestinal epithelium and IgG is released from FcRn into blood or tissue fluids. Throughout life, contributes to effective humoral immunity by recycling IgG and extending its half-life in the circulation. Mechanistically, monomeric IgG binding to FcRn in acidic endosomes of endothelial and hematopoietic cells recycles IgG to the cell surface where it is released into the circulation. In addition of IgG, regulates homeostasis of the other most abundant circulating protein albumin/ALB.
Gene References into Functions
  1. The main function of hepatic FcRn is to direct albumin into the circulation, thereby also increasing hepatocyte sensitivity to toxicity. PMID:28330995
  2. Preproinsulin fused to Fc administered to pregnant mice efficiently accumulated in fetuses through the placental neonatal Fc receptor and protected them from subsequent diabetes development. PMID:25918233
  3. The neonatal Fc receptor (FcRn) binds independently to both sites of the IgG homodimer with identical affinity. PMID:25658443
  4. Characterization and screening of IgG binding to the neonatal Fc receptor. PMID:24802048
  5. Fc receptor promotes formation of subepithelial immune complexes and subsequent glomerular pathology leading to proteinuria PMID:24357670
  6. Abundant intracellular IgG in enterocytes and endoderm lacking FcRn. PMID:23923029
  7. Extending serum half-life of albumin by engineering neonatal Fc receptor (FcRn) binding. PMID:24652290
  8. FcRn thus has a primary role within mucosal tissues in activating local immune responses that are critical for priming efficient anti-tumor immunosurveillance PMID:24290911
  9. Neonatal Fc receptor for IgG uptake mediates intestinal absorption of IgG(1) anti-IgE/IgE immune complexes. PMID:23181795
  10. AMG 386 clearance in FcRn-knockout mice was 18-fold faster at the 3-mg/kg dose. PMID:22189693
  11. an increase in lymphoid follicles and Helicobacter bacterial load in knock-out mice PMID:22089027
  12. Data show that FcRn traps antigen and protects it from degradation within an acidic loading compartment in association with the rapid recruitment of key components of the phagosome-to-cytosol cross-presentation machinery. PMID:21628593
  13. Findings reveal that FcRn expression has a different effect on Ag processing and presentation of ICs to CD4(+) T cells in the endosomal versus phagosomal compartments of Ms versus DCs. PMID:21402891
  14. These studies demonstrate that FcRn-mediated transport is a mechanism by which IgG can act locally in the female genital tract in immune surveillance and in host defense against sexually transmitted diseases. PMID:21368166
  15. Fetal, but not maternal, FcRn is required for induction of Fetal and neonatal immune thrombocytopenia. PMID:20647570
  16. No binding of albumin was observed at physiological pH to neonatal Fc receptor. At acidic pH, a 100-fold difference in binding affinity was observed. PMID:20018855
  17. Mouse FcRn is promiscuous in its antibody binding specificity, interacting with IgG from human, mouse, rabbit, guinea pig, bovine, sheep and rat. PMID:11717196
  18. Direct evidence is provided that FcRn is responsible for both perinatal IgG transport and IgG homeostatic function. PMID:12646614
  19. FcRn promotes humorally mediated autoimmune disease. PMID:15124024
  20. sequence analysis of promoter indicates that availability of specific TFs may contribute to the regulation of Fcgrt expression PMID:15627500
  21. the amount of albumin saved from degradation by FcRn-mediated recycling is the same as that produced by the liver PMID:16210471
  22. report a therapeutic strategy to beneficially alter the pharmacokinetics of IgG antibodies via pharmacological inhibition of the neonatal Fc receptor (FcRn) using high-dose IgG therapy PMID:17717602
  23. Mice lacking FcRn accumulated IgG in the glomerular basement membrane as they aged, and tracer studies showed delayed clearance of IgG from the kidneys of FcRn-deficient mice PMID:18198272
  24. FcRn maintains levels of pathogenic autoantibodies and thereby promotes tissue injury in experimental epidermolysis bullosa acquisita. PMID:18542899
  25. A previously undescribed role for FcRn in mediating the presentation of antigens by dendritic cells when antigens are present as a complex with antibody, is shown. PMID:18599440
  26. The intracellular trafficking pathway and functions of FcRn may be altered by the association of major histocompatibility (MHC) class II invariant chain (Ii) during physiological and inflammatory conditions. PMID:18684948
  27. Results indicate that FcRn-dependent internalization of IgG may be important not only in cells taking up IgG from an extracellular acidic space, but also in endothelial cells participating in homeostatic regulation of circulating IgG levels. PMID:18843053
  28. FcRn is responsible for virtually all immunoglobulin G transport from mother to fetus during gestation. PMID:19234152
  29. renal FcRn reclaims albumin, thereby maintaining the serum concentration of albumin, but facilitates the loss of IgG from plasma protein pools PMID:19661163

Subcellular Location
Cell membrane; Single-pass type I membrane protein. Endosome membrane.
Protein Families
Immunoglobulin superfamily
Tissue Specificity
Intestinal epithelium of suckling rodents. Expressed in neonatal intestine and fetal yolk sac.
